A senior journalist and reporter with the Nigerian Television Authority, Tunde Saiki, is dead.

His death was confirmed by the Chairman of Nigerian Union of Journalists (NUJ), Lagos Council, Dr. Qasim Akinreti.

According to Akinreti, the deceased died at the NTA Victoria Island, Lagos Office on Friday morning.

“Dear colleagues, we just lost one of our members in NTA Victoria Island chapel , Mr. Tunde Saiki .

“According to the text message from the NTA Chapel chairman, Tunde died in the office this morning and his corpse deposited at the morgue.

“I spoke with Deola NTA Chapel chairman. May God forgive him of his shortcomings.

“My condolences to his family and the NTA management,” Akinreti said.
